Associate Recruitment Business Partner

Nozomi Networks is the leader in OT and IoT cybersecurity, keeping the world's critical infrastructure cyber resilient through real-time asset visibility, threat detection, and AI-powered analysis. We protect the toughest operational environments — from energy and healthcare to manufacturing and beyond.
Job Description
We are seeking an Associate Recruitment Business Partner to join our team on a permanent basis. Based in Europe, you will run end-to-end hiring across Sales and Corporate functions globally, working closely with hiring managers and supported by the wider Talent Acquisition team.
This is a great opportunity to build your career in talent acquisition. You will contribute to hiring outcomes, help improve our processes, and play a real part in how we scale and are perceived in the market. You will bring a technology-enabled approach to talent acquisition, helping us attract and hire exceptional talent efficiently and consistently.
In this role, you will:
- Deliver end-to-end recruitment across a portfolio of roles (req intake → offer), maintaining pace, quality, and accountability at every stage
- Work in partnership with hiring managers, running structured intake sessions and helping define success profiles and hiring approaches
- Follow and help strengthen our hiring processes, ensuring consistent, structured, and inclusive interview practices
- Use Greenhouse ATS as your core operating system, maintaining high data integrity, pipeline visibility, and reporting accuracy
- Help keep workflows, scorecards, and interview kits up to date and fit for purpose
- Support the build and execution of proactive talent strategies
+ Build and nurture pipelines across active and passive talent
+ Gather market insights and competitor mapping to inform our hiring approach
- Use AI and modern sourcing techniques to increase your productivity and reach,
- Apply AI tools for sourcing & screening
- Experiment with automation and data insights to improve funnel efficiency
- Deliver an exceptional candidate experience acting as a candidate ambassador from first touch to offer
- Manage multiple requisitions with discipline and structure
+ Prioritise effectively, keep clear hiring plans, and maintain momentum
- Contribute to the TA function by supporting global projects (e.g. process improvement, employer branding, interview excellence)
- Champion Nozomi Networks’ culture and values, bringing trust, transparency, and high performance to all hiring activity
To be successful in this opportunity, you will have:
- Some experience in full lifecycle recruitment, ideally within a high-growth, high-tech environment. Global exposure is a plus.
- Exposure to hiring for Sales and/or Corporate roles
- Comfortable working with hiring managers and contributing to hiring decisions
- Hands-on experience with Greenhouse ATS is strongly preferred to limit ramp time, including reporting, workflows, and stakeholder support
- Familiarity with AI tools in recruitment (sourcing, screening, automation), or a keen interest in learning them
- Working understanding of structured interviewing and assessment best practices
- Ability to manage several searches at once, maintaining quality and pace
- Data-minded, with an interest in turning insights into action
- Highly organised, proactive, and execution-focused
- Commercially curious, with developing judgement on candidate quality and market dynamics
- Comfortable working in a remote environment, with flexibility across time zones
- Any exposure to Cybersecurity is welcome (OT/IoT a plus, not essential)
